YAML Validátor
Extension Actions
Validujte YAML online s podporou schém pre Kubernetes, Docker Compose, GitHub Actions. Linter a formátovač v jednom nástroji.
🔧 Validujte súbory yaml proti 11 oficiálnym schémam s automatickou detekciou. YAML Validator vám pomôže odhaliť chyby pred nasadením pomocou validácie schém pre Kubernetes, Docker Compose a CI/CD pipeline.
✨ Novinky vo verzii 1.1
- Validácia schém pre 11 platforiem s automatickou detekciou
- Skladanie kódu na GitHube pre prehliadanie veľkých konfiguračných súborov
- Režim Otvoriť v karte pre úpravy na celú obrazovku
- Podpora tmavého režimu s detekciou systémového motívu
- Zvýraznenie chybových riadkov s navigáciou kliknutím
📋 Podporované schémy
Validujte yaml online proti oficiálnym špecifikáciám:
1️⃣ Kubernetes v1.29 - k8s yaml validátor pre Deployment, Service, Pod, ConfigMap, Ingress, StatefulSet, DaemonSet, CronJob a 20+ typov prostriedkov
2️⃣ Docker Compose v2.29 - docker compose validátor s plnou podporou špecifikácií
3️⃣ GitHub Actions - github actions yaml validátor pre automatizáciu pracovných postupov CI/CD
4️⃣ GitLab CI - gitlab ci yaml validátor pre pipeline .gitlab-ci.yml
5️⃣ CircleCI - circleci yaml validátor pre konfigurácie zostavenia config.yml
6️⃣ Azure Pipelines - azure pipelines yaml validátor pre devops pracovné postupy
7️⃣ Bitbucket Pipelines - bitbucket yaml validátor pre konfigurácie pipeline
8️⃣ Ansible - ansible yaml validátor pre automatizačné skripty playbook
9️⃣ Helm Charts - helm yaml validátor pre správu balíkov Chart.yaml
🔟 OpenAPI 3.0 - openapi yaml validátor pre špecifikácie REST API
⬛ Swagger 2.0 - swagger yaml validátor pre špecifikácie API
🎯 Inteligentná detekcia chýb
Rozšírenie automaticky detekuje, ktorá schéma sa vzťahuje na váš obsah:
▸ Vložte kód a zodpovedajúca schéma je okamžite detekovaná
▸ Zvýraznenie chybových riadkov ukazuje presné umiestnenie problému
▸ Podpora viacerých dokumentov s oddeľovačmi ---
▸ Návrhy nezhody schémy s opravou jedným kliknutím
📂 Skladanie kódu na GitHube
Prehliadate konfiguračné súbory na GitHube? Toto rozšírenie pridáva tlačidlo pre skladanie:
• Zbaľte a rozbaľte sekcie na akejkoľvek stránke repozitára GitHub
• Ľahko prechádzajte veľké konfiguračné súbory
• Funguje s akýmkoľvek súborom .yaml alebo .yml na GitHube
• Prepínajte skladanie jedným kliknutím
💡 Kľúčové vlastnosti
➤ Kontrola syntaxe s okamžitou spätnou väzbou pre váš kód
➤ Linter včas identifikuje štrukturálne a sémantické problémy
➤ Formátovač udržuje kód čistý a čitateľný
➤ Validácia schémy proti oficiálnym špecifikáciám
➤ Kubernetes yaml validátor pre k8s manifesty a nasadenia
➤ Docker compose kontrola pred spustením kontajnerov
🚀 Vytvorené pre DevOps inžinierov
Navrhnuté pre vývojárov, správcov systémov a profesionálov DevOps:
1. Validácia Kubernetes - skontrolujte k8s manifesty pred kubectl apply, aby ste predišli zlyhaniam
2. Overenie Docker Compose - zachyťte chyby konfigurácie pred docker compose up
3. Validácia CI/CD pipeline - podpora pre GitHub Actions, GitLab CI, CircleCI, Azure Pipelines
4. Kontrola špecifikácií API - validácia formátu OpenAPI a Swagger pre REST API
5. Infrastructure as Code - podpora pre Ansible playbook a konfiguráciu Helm chart
📝 Ako používať toto rozšírenie
- Kliknite na ikonu rozšírenia na paneli s nástrojmi prehliadača
- Vložte svoj kód do oblasti editora
- Schéma je detekovaná automaticky alebo vyberte manuálne z rozbaľovacieho zoznamu
- Kliknite na tlačidlo Validate pre kontrolu syntaxe a súladu so schémou
- Chyby sú zvýraznené číslami riadkov pre rýchlu navigáciu
🌐 Prehliadačový Yaml Validator Online
Validujte súbory yaml priamo vo svojom prehliadači bez externých nástrojov:
◆ Funguje úplne offline po inštalácii
◆ Žiadne dáta sa neodosielajú na externé servery
◆ Váš konfiguračný kód zostáva úplne súkromný
◆ Téma tmavého režimu pre pohodlné relácie úprav
◆ Otvoriť v karte poskytuje rozšírený pracovný priestor pre väčšie súbory
◆ Trvalé úložisko ukladá vašu prácu medzi reláciami
🔍 Možnosti Lintingu a Formátovania
Zahrnuté komplexné funkcie kvality kódu:
▪ Detekujte chyby syntaxe okamžite pri písaní
▪ Skontrolujte štruktúru proti špecifikáciám json schema
▪ Formátujte kód pre lepšiu čitateľnosť a konzistenciu
▪ Overte štruktúru konfigurácie pred nasadením
▪ Parsovanie viacerých dokumentov pre zložité konfiguračné balíčky
⚡ Kontrola konfigurácie naprieč platformami
Podporuje konfigurácie naprieč viacerými platformami a prostrediami:
• Kubernetes yaml validácia pre cloud-native aplikácie a mikroslužby
• Docker compose yaml kontrola pre orchestráciu kontajnerov
• GitHub actions validátor pre pipeline kontinuálnej integrácie
• Gitlab ci linter pre automatizované procesy zostavenia a nasadenia
• Circleci config kontrola pre cloudovú automatizáciu zostavenia
• Ansible playbook validácia pre automatizáciu infraštruktúry
❓ Často kladené otázky
Q: Funguje toto rozšírenie offline?
A: Áno, po inštalácii prebieha všetka validácia lokálne vo vašom prehliadači.
Q: Odosiela sa môj kód na nejaký server?
A: Nie, vaša konfigurácia zostáva úplne súkromná na vašom zariadení.
Q: Aká verzia Kubernetes je podporovaná?
A: V súčasnosti podporuje Kubernetes v1.29 s 23 typmi prostriedkov.
✅ Stiahnite si YAML Validator pre rýchlu a spoľahlivú kontrolu konfiguračných súborov. Validujte yaml online s kubernetes yaml validátorom, docker compose kontrolou a 11 typmi schém.
Latest reviews
- Nikolay Nikolaev
- Works great. Fast and Accurate.
- Ann Golovatuk
- A bit simple, but it works. I like yaml highlighting on external sites, like github!
- Vladyslav Vorobiov
- I need such tool in order to have handy validator for yaml configs in the browser. Meets my expectations so far